Surrounding the spectacular Semeru Volcano, Bromo-Tengger-Semeru National Park lies 70 mi/112 km southeast of Surabaya. It was closed temporarily in mid-2004 because of volcanic eruptions and was briefly put on heightened alert in 2006 and again in 2011 and 2016. Check its status before visiting.

Attractions include excellent hiking (the best time is April-November), interesting mountain villages and crater lakes. Guides and horses may be hired for a trip into the caldera. The sunrise viewed from the top is a must, but be sure to take some warm clothes—it gets very cold at the summit. https://bromotenggersemeru.org.
